
#手机游戏程序开发,创意与技术的融合之旅简介
在数字娱乐产业蓬勃发展的今天,手机游戏已经成为人们日常生活中不可或缺的一部分,随着智能手机的普及和技术的进步,手机游戏程序开发领域迎来了前所未有的机遇与挑战,本文将深入探讨手机游戏程序开发的各个方面,从创意构思到技术实现,再到市场推广,为读者揭开手机游戏开发的神秘面纱。
一、创意构思:游戏的灵魂
手机游戏的成功,首先源于一个吸引人的创意,游戏开发者需要从玩家的角度出发,思考什么样的游戏能够引起共鸣,什么样的游戏机制能够带来乐趣,创意构思阶段,开发者需要考虑以下几个方面:
1、目标受众:确定游戏的目标玩家群体,是儿童、青少年还是成人,这将直接影响游戏的设计和内容。
2、游戏类型:选择游戏的类型,如角色扮演、策略、动作、解谜等,每种类型都有其特定的玩家基础和市场。
3、故事情节:一个引人入胜的故事可以增加游戏的吸引力,让玩家沉浸在游戏世界中。
4、游戏机制:创新的游戏机制能够为玩家带来新鲜感,提高游戏的可玩性。
二、技术实现:游戏的骨架
有了创意之后,接下来就是将这些想法转化为实际的游戏程序,技术实现阶段,开发者需要关注以下几个关键点:
1、编程语言:选择适合手机游戏开发的编程语言,如C#、Java、Swift等。
2、游戏引擎:利用游戏引擎如Unity、Unreal Engine等,可以大大加快开发进程,提高游戏质量。
3、图形设计:高质量的图形设计能够提升游戏的视觉体验,吸引玩家。
4、音效与音乐:合适的音效和背景音乐能够增强游戏的沉浸感。
5、性能优化:考虑到手机硬件的限制,优化游戏性能,确保流畅的游戏体验。
三、用户体验:游戏的血液
在手机游戏程序开发中,用户体验是至关重要的,开发者需要确保游戏易于上手,同时具有足够的深度和挑战性,以保持玩家的兴趣,以下是提升用户体验的一些方法:
1、界面设计:直观的用户界面设计可以帮助玩家快速理解游戏规则和操作。
2、教程与引导:为新手玩家提供教程和引导,帮助他们快速上手。
3、反馈机制:及时的游戏反馈可以增强玩家的成就感,如得分、等级提升等。
4、社交功能:集成社交功能,如排行榜、好友系统等,可以增加游戏的粘性。
四、测试与调试:游戏的体检
在游戏开发过程中,测试和调试是不可或缺的环节,它们确保游戏在发布前能够达到预期的质量标准,以下是测试和调试的一些关键点:
1、功能测试:确保所有游戏功能都能正常工作,没有bug。
2、性能测试:测试游戏在不同设备上的性能,确保流畅运行。
3、用户测试:通过用户测试收集反馈,了解玩家的需求和偏好。
4、安全性测试:确保游戏的安全性,防止数据泄露和黑客攻击。
五、市场推广:游戏的翅膀
即使是一款优秀的手机游戏,如果没有有效的市场推广,也很难获得成功,以下是一些市场推广的策略:
1、社交媒体营销:利用社交媒体平台,如Facebook、Twitter、Instagram等,进行游戏宣传。
2、合作伙伴关系:与其他游戏公司或平台建立合作关系,共同推广游戏。
3、广告投放:在游戏平台和应用商店投放广告,吸引潜在玩家。
4、口碑营销:鼓励玩家分享游戏,通过口碑传播吸引新玩家。
六、持续更新:游戏的生命力
手机游戏的生命周期很大程度上取决于开发者是否能够持续提供新内容和更新,以下是一些持续更新的策略:
1、新关卡和内容:定期推出新的游戏关卡和内容,保持游戏的新鲜感。
2、节日活动:利用节日和特殊事件推出限时活动,增加玩家的参与度。
3、玩家反馈:根据玩家的反馈进行游戏改进,提升游戏体验。
4、技术升级:随着技术的发展,不断升级游戏,提供更好的视觉效果和性能。
手机游戏程序开发是一个复杂而充满挑战的过程,它涉及到创意、技术、用户体验、测试、市场推广和持续更新等多个方面,开发者需要具备跨学科的知识,同时保持对市场动态的敏感度,才能在这个竞争激烈的行业中获得成功,随着技术的不断进步和玩家需求的日益增长,手机游戏程序开发将继续是一个充满活力和创新的领域。